Aston Villa predicted XI vs Leeds United: Gerrard’s first selection as Premier League resumes

Gerrard will select his first Villa team for over two weeks on Wednesday evening

Aston Villa return to Premier League action on Wednesday evening when they welcome Marcelo Bielsa’s Leeds United to Villa Park.

It’s the first time Villa have played a competitive fixture since January 22 due to the South American international break - a break which involved a number of Gerrard’s men jetting off to represent their country.

Emiliano Martinez went off to represent Argentina whilst Philippe Coutinho linked up with Brazil.

And not forgetting Emiliano Buendia, January’s player of the month, who also followed Martinez away with Argentina and was awarded his first ever CAP during the break, capping off an incredible few weeks for Villa’s record signing.

There was of course the now concluded Africa Cup of Nations ongoing during this same period which involved Bertrand Traore and Trezeguet, so whilst there may have been no Premier League football in this time, it has been a busy couple of weeks for some of Gerrard’s men.

Which may make Wednesday evening’s selection more difficult than it arguably would have been.
